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Sydney to Silverwater Correctional Complex is to drive which costs $4 - $6 and takes 17 min.
The fastest way to get from Sydney to Silverwater Correctional Complex is to taxi which takes 17 min and costs $50 - $65.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Town Hall, Park St, Stand H and arriving at Newington Community Centre, Avenue Of Europe. Services depart four times a day, and operate Thursday, Friday, Saturday and Sunday. The journey takes approximately 53 min.
The distance between Sydney and Silverwater Correctional Complex is 28 km. The road distance is 20.6 km.
The best way to get from Sydney to Silverwater Correctional Complex without a car is to train and line 526 bus which takes 40 min and costs $6 - $11.
It takes approximately 40 min to get from Sydney to Silverwater Correctional Complex, including transfers.
Sydney to Silverwater Correctional Complex bus services, operated by Busways, depart from Town Hall, Park St, Stand H station.
Sydney to Silverwater Correctional Complex bus services, operated by Busways, arrive at Newington Community Centre, Avenue Of Europe station.
Yes, the driving distance between Sydney to Silverwater Correctional Complex is 21 km. It takes approximately 17 min to drive from Sydney to Silverwater Correctional Complex.

What companies run services between Sydney, NSW, Australia and Silverwater Correctional Complex, NSW, Australia?
Busways operates a bus from Town Hall, Park St, Stand H to Newington Community Centre, Avenue Of Europe 4 times a day. Tickets cost $5–7 and the journey takes 53 min. Alternatively, Sydney Ferries operates a ferry from Barangaroo, Wharf 1, Side B to Sydney Olympic Park Wharf, Side A every 30 minutes. Tickets cost $7–10 and the journey takes 45 min.
